Powerscourt Terrace Café is a cafe, located at Powerscourt House, Powerscourt Demesne, Enniskerry, Co. Wicklow, Ireland. They can be contacted via phone at +353 1 204 6000, visit their website www.powerscourt.ie for more detailed information.
